1. Troubleshooting Razer Keyboard Issues

Here are a few key steps to troubleshoot and potentially resolve your Razer keyboard problems:

1. Check Physical Connections

Ensure that the keyboard is securely connected to your computer via its USB cable. If possible, try using a different USB port or cable to eliminate connection issues.

2. Update Drivers and Software

Outdated drivers or software can lead to compatibility problems. Visit the Razer website to download and install the latest updates for your keyboard model.

3. Restart Your Computer

A simple restart can often resolve temporary glitches and software conflicts. Shut down your computer, unplug the keyboard, wait a few minutes, and then reconnect the keyboard and restart your system.

4. Clean the Keyboard

Accumulated dust or debris can interfere with keystrokes. Use a soft brush or compressed air to gently remove any dirt or particles from the keyboard.

2. FAQs about Razer Keyboard Issues

Q: What should I do if my Razer keyboard keys are not working?

Check for physical damage to the keys or keyboard, and ensure that the keyboard is properly connected. Clean the keys and try updating the drivers.

Q: How do I fix a stuck key on my Razer keyboard?

Gently try to dislodge the key by pressing and releasing it several times. If that doesn’t work, remove the keycap (if possible) and clean any debris underneath.

Q: My Razer keyboard is not recognized by my computer.

Try connecting the keyboard to a different USB port or computer. Check the Device Manager to see if the keyboard is detected. If not, uninstall and reinstall the keyboard drivers.

Q: How can I prevent future Razer keyboard issues?

Regular cleaning, updating drivers, and avoiding liquid spills can help maintain the longevity of your Razer keyboard.

6. Hardware

The hardware components of a Razer keyboard play a critical role in its functionality, and any issues with these components can lead to the keyboard. Understanding the different hardware aspects and their potential impact can help you troubleshoot and resolve problems more effectively.

  • Switches:

    The switches are the individual components that register keystrokes. Worn-out, damaged, or faulty switches can cause keys to become unresponsive or register unintended inputs. This issue is particularly common in keyboards that have seen heavy use or have not been properly maintained.

  • Key Matrix:

    The key matrix is the network of electrical connections that allows the keyboard to determine which key has been pressed. Damage to the key matrix, such as broken traces or loose connections, can result in keys not registering or registering incorrectly.

  • Controller:

    The controller is the central processing unit of the keyboard. It is responsible for managing the input from the keys and communicating with the computer. A malfunctioning controller can cause the keyboard to become unresponsive or behave erratically.

  • USB Cable:

    The USB cable connects the keyboard to the computer and transmits data between the two devices. A damaged or faulty USB cable can lead to intermittent connections, data loss, or complete failure of the keyboard.

By understanding the potential hardware issues that can affect a Razer keyboard, you can better diagnose and resolve problems, ensuring optimal performance and extending the lifespan of your keyboard.

7. Software

Software plays a critical role in the functionality of a Razer keyboard. It provides the instructions and commands that allow the keyboard to communicate with the computer and perform its intended functions. Without properly functioning software, the keyboard may become unresponsive or exhibit erratic behavior, hindering its usability.

One common software-related issue that can affect Razer keyboards is outdated or corrupted drivers. Drivers are small software programs that act as intermediaries between the operating system and the hardware device. When drivers are outdated or corrupted, they can cause compatibility problems or prevent the keyboard from functioning correctly.

Another potential software issue is conflicts with other programs or applications. If multiple programs are trying to access the keyboard simultaneously, it can lead to resource conflicts and cause the keyboard to malfunction. Additionally, certain third-party software, such as overclocking utilities or macro management programs, may interfere with the keyboard’s software and cause problems.

Understanding the connection between software and Razer keyboard issues is crucial for effective troubleshooting. By being aware of the potential software-related causes, users can take appropriate steps to resolve the problem, such as updating drivers, resolving software conflicts, or reinstalling the keyboard software.
